PNG is country rich in cultural diversity, stunning natural landscapes, and a passion for sports.
Sports play a vital role in promoting democratic values and fostering a sense of national unity and pride.
From rugby league to football and cricket, sports has the power to promote equality, and encourage peaceful coexistence in a country with a complex history.
The passion for sports in PNG is unparalleled, as it unites people from different tribes, languages, and social backgrounds to come together in support of their teams and athletes.
This collective enthusiasm for sports transcends societal barriers and fosters a spirit of unity and togetherness.
In a country with over 800 different languages and a diverse range of cultural traditions, sports provide a shared platform for people to connect and celebrate their national identity.
Moreover, sports in PNG serve as a vehicle for promoting democratic values such as equality, fairness, and inclusivity.
Through sports, individuals are given the opportunity to showcase their talent and skill regardless of their background.
This promotes the notion that everyone should have an equal chance to succeed and thrive, regardless of their social status or ethnicity. Athletes are celebrated for their achievements, and their success becomes a source of inspiration for others, demonstrating that meritocracy and fair competition are fundamental democratic principles.
Furthermore, sports in PNG often embody the values of teamwork, discipline, and respect for others, which are essential components of a democratic society.
Team sports, in particular, teach individuals the importance of working together towards a common goal, sharing responsibilities, and respecting each other’s contributions.
These values are not only essential for success in sports but are also fundamental in building a cohesive and harmonious society.
In addition to promoting democratic values, sports also serve as a platform for social inclusion and empowerment, especially for marginalised communities and groups.
In PNG, sports programs have been successful in engaging youth from disadvantaged backgrounds, providing them with opportunities to develop valuable life skills, self-esteem, and a sense of belonging.
These initiatives contribute to the empowerment of individuals, giving them a voice and a platform to express themselves, which are essential elements of a thriving democratic society.
Furthermore, sports have the power to promote peace and understanding among different communities. In a diverse country like PNG, where ethnic and tribal tensions have sometimes led to conflicts, sports serve as a unifying force, bringing people together in a spirit of camaraderie and mutual respect.
Sporting events and competitions create a forum for interaction, dialogue, and cultural exchange, fostering a sense of national pride and solidarity while breaking down barriers that may exist between different groups.
Moreover, the promotion of gender equality and the empowerment of women through sports play a crucial role in advancing democratic values in PNG.
Female athletes in PNG have made significant strides in various sports, challenging traditional gender roles and inspiring other women and girls to pursue their aspirations.
Their success showcases the importance of gender equality and the valuable contributions that women make to sports and society, promoting the principles of inclusivity and diversity that are integral to a democratic society.
In conclusion, sports have a profound influence in promoting democratic values in Papua New Guinea. Through their ability to unite people, dismantle social barriers, and promote inclusivity and equality, sports play a crucial role in fostering a democratic and cohesive society. As PNG continues to harness the power of sports, it is essential to recognise and support its role in building a stronger, more inclusive, and democratic nation.
